diff options
author | jim-p <jimp@pfsense.org> | 2012-12-07 09:32:25 -0500 |
---|---|---|
committer | jim-p <jimp@pfsense.org> | 2012-12-07 09:32:25 -0500 |
commit | 2c6de2ea27e40dece742079389615211c66075ed (patch) | |
tree | 6b58e137a8cecdc2750bf1cb75f255c82abbd9ef /etc/inc/vpn.inc | |
parent | 1df0e80acbdc76136267e3cddadb51e0dbe3b21e (diff) | |
download | pfsense-2c6de2ea27e40dece742079389615211c66075ed.zip pfsense-2c6de2ea27e40dece742079389615211c66075ed.tar.gz |
Also consider 0.0.0.0/0 here since it fails both these tests but is still a valid/special config.
Diffstat (limited to 'etc/inc/vpn.inc')
-rw-r--r-- | etc/inc/vpn.inc |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/etc/inc/vpn.inc b/etc/inc/vpn.inc index fec3d89..26d8bcb 100644 --- a/etc/inc/vpn.inc +++ b/etc/inc/vpn.inc @@ -685,7 +685,7 @@ EOD; $localid_type = "subnet"; } // Don't let an empty subnet into racoon.conf, it can cause parse errors. Ticket #2201. - if (!is_ipaddr($localid_data) && !is_subnet($localid_data)) { + if (!is_ipaddr($localid_data) && !is_subnet($localid_data) && ($localid_data != "0.0.0.0/0")) { log_error("Invalid IPsec Phase 2 \"{$ph2ent['descr']}\" - {$ph2ent['localid']['type']} has no subnet."); continue; } |